om... BUT.......for us who could not make it to the Convention, could we have some reports, stories. Atlanta was the eighteenth or nineteenth SSA convention for my wife and me. While I never fail to find something new and exciting in both the presentations (this year, the "news" from Steve Northcraft and Bob Lacovara were the most informative, with Mark Keene's marathan two session discussion close in trail) and the exhibits (the prototype sport aviation certified glider caught my eye), I've come to treasure even more the once-a-year chance to hob nob and lift a glass with the luminaries of soaring that you'd otherwise only read about. The new film "A Fine Week of Soaring" was a particular surprise . . . sitting in the room, when it was described as a "close look at a full week of a contest" I whispered to my wife "I've seen too many boring videos of competitions . . when the lights dim, I'm going to sneak out". Well, a little over an hour later, I was still there, enthralled, and promptly skipped out to buy two copies. Didn't hurt that sometimes, flying my own glider down in the Shenandoah valley, I've "lurked" on frequency about a hundred miles out while Karl talked some of his XC trainees around a course. .. . the film visualized what I'd heard in the chit-chat. Very cool. Enjoyed Dennis Wright's plain-talking membership meeting (where WAS everyone?!?) and the dialog with the CAP Glider Program folks. It was obvious that big things are a-brewin', new instruments and new gliders notwithstanding . . There was a self launching version of the Apis (15M) on display at the Apis
Sailplanes Inc Booth. It was a very nice looking machine with a very reasonable price. A friend who flies an L-33 sat in it and felt the cockpit was very comfortable. It appears they have done a nice job.
